Q: Is 130,565,322 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 130,565,322 is not a prime number.

Why is 130,565,322 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 130565322 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 9 18 613 1,226 1,839 3,678 5,517 11,034 11,833 23,666 35,499 70,998 106,497 212,994 7,253,629 14,507,258 21,760,887 43,521,774 65,282,661 and 130,565,322, with no remainder.

Since 130,565,322 cannot be divided by just 1 and 130,565,322, it is not a prime number.
